MPs speak with reporters on Parliament Hill as they convene for the daily question period in the House of Commons. They face questions on the Conservative Party’s opposition motion that calls on the House of Commons to endorse an oil pipeline to the B.C. coast.

Speaking are Government House Leader Steven MacKinnon, Liberal MPs Carlos Leitão, Steven Guilbeault, Ben Carr and Anthony Housefather, NDP interim leader Don Davies and NDP MP Alexandre Boulerice, and Conservative MP Gabriel Hardy.
